Sharing an Altered Apothecary Bottle today!



Altered Apothecary Bottle



Supplies:
Vintage 8" Green Square Glass Apothecary Bottle
Brown Paper Bag
Burlap Twine
Matte Medium
Black Acrylic Paint
Crackle Finish
Homemade Texture Paste
"Ray Of Light" Die  by Seth Apter
Lucky Shamrock, Hydrangea Blue, Ramblin Rose-Starburst Sprays
Yellow Gold Water Color
Watercolor Brush
Large Metal Key
Small Metal Triangle
Altered "T" Bottle Cap
Chain (Painted Black)
Metal Clasp
3 Clear Gems
Orange Gem
Tacky Glue
